Depends on WEP available (5 min on Merlins vs 9+ minutes on LW birds). I never cruise on WEP, I sometimes use it to accelerate to cruise speeds or climb to cruise alt, and I never use it for more than 2 minutes without letting it cool when not in combat. Once in combat, it comes on until I disengage of get low on fuel.

For me its usually only on when I need that little bit of extra performance, being a runstang dweeb thats usually on the way out with half a dozen bandits in tow. During the fight I only use it to keep as close to corner velocity as possible, or in a hard 1v1 turnfight. Otherwise its off cause I wanna know that when I need it it will be there. So often I'd be chasing some guy who's slowly going away from me, then suddenly I'm catching him. I just know hes run outta wep. I try to make sure I don't end up the same way.
